Output 62a26fe36b2ef3043e1b41287fc3fdc8e9376760c01cd2a76a3c72788e8a1f7b:3

value
507171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3e3410689234ef4e1fdce869ed3e1f3218979f6 OP_EQUAL
address
3NTyYyUAfcQpyvYDqYvJ286W6utGC9Rd9G
transaction
62a26fe36b2ef3043e1b41287fc3fdc8e9376760c01cd2a76a3c72788e8a1f7b
spent
true